SPORTING.

Ashburton Races.

There was perfect weather and a large attendance. The following are the results on Thursday:— Hunters Flat; li mile.—The Shark, list 121 b, 1; Nenthorn, list, 2; Chance, list 121 b, 3. Time, 2mih 51sec; dividend, £2 17s.

Ashburton Racing Club Handicap; 1J miles.—Prime Warden, 9st slb, 1; Au Revoir, 9st 31b, 2; Aqualate, 7st 12lb, 3. Time, 2min 12sec ; dividend, £3 3s. Disposal Stakes; 6 furlongs.—Nenthorne, 7st, 1; Jack, Bst 101 b, 2 ; Kaiser, 7st X2lb, 3. Time, Imin 18seo; dividend, £4 Is. The winner was bought in for £l6. Open Welter Handicap; 1 mile.—Abel Tasman, Bst 121 b, 1; Reflector, 9s 111 b, 2; Invader, Bst 91b, 3. Time, Imin 45sec; dividend, £4 14s.

Hakatere Steeplechase; 3 miles.—J oker, list 41b, 1; Victor, 9st lllb, 2 ; Justice, list 131 b, 3. Time, 7min ssec; dividend, £2l3s.

Winchmore Handicap; 1J mile.—Lord Zetland, Bst 81b, 1; Speculator, Bst 51b, 2; Manilla, 7st lllb, 3. Time, 2min 17sec; dividend, £llßs.

Flying Handicap; 6 furlongs.—Barmby, 7st 101 b, 1; Jess, 6at- 71b, 2; Saracen, 9at 121 b, 3. Time, Imin 14sec; dividend, £3 3s.

At the Australian Jockey Club’s Meeting at Sydney on i Thursday the Hurdles ,was won by Billy Boy, Craven Plate by Patron, Suburban Handicap by Musketooh,'Sixth Biennial by Nobleman, Wycombe Stakes by Atlas, and Sydney Handicap by Royal Rose.
